What is the violent crime rate in Jenks?

The estimated violent crime rate in Jenks is 210.8 per 100,000 residents, which is 45% lower than the national average. This means residents have roughly a 1 in 474 chance of becoming a violent crime victim each year. Key violent crime rates include: murder at 2.8 per 100K (45% below average); aggravated assault at 159.1 per 100K (41% below average); robbery at 31.7 per 100K (57% below average).

What is the property crime rate in Jenks?

The estimated property crime rate in Jenks is 1,448.4 per 100,000 residents, which is 21% lower than the national average. Residents have roughly a 1 in 69 chance of being a property crime victim per year. Key property crime rates include: burglary at 309.1 per 100K (15% above average); larceny/theft at 917.6 per 100K (35% below average); vehicle theft at 221.7 per 100K (30% below average).

How does Jenks crime compare to the national average?

Jenks's overall crime rate is 53% below the national average as of 2026. The biggest concern is burglary (15% above average), while robbery is 57% below average. Compared to other major U.S. cities, Jenks has lower crime than 99% of them.

How does Jenks crime compare to the rest of Oklahoma?

Oklahoma as a whole has crime that is 18% above the national average. Jenks's crime rate is 53% below the national average, making it safer the typical Oklahoma city.

What type of crime is most common in Jenks?

Larceny/theft is the most common crime in Jenks, with an estimated rate of 917.6 incidents per 100,000 residents. This is 35% below the national average for this crime type. Overall, property crime (1,448 per 100K) is more prevalent than violent crime (211 per 100K) in Jenks, which is consistent with national trends.
